WebJul 4, 2012 · Hand-Washing Linen. To properly hand-wash linen, place it in a clean sink with cool water and mild detergent. Gently agitate the clothing items, then remove them from the soapy water. Drain the soapy water, rinse the sink and refill with cool water. Rinse the garments and repeat until the water is soap-free.

You … how much is medivet worthWebAug 4, 2024 · Although they are similar fabrics, linen does have some advantages over cotton, and also some deficits. Linen can be two to three times stronger than cotton, and it dries at a much faster rate—a quality that helps it dissipate heat faster.
